Home
last modified time | relevance | path

Searched refs:ScalarIV (Results 1 – 1 of 1) sorted by relevance

/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Vectorize/
DLoopVectorize.cpp575 void buildScalarSteps(Value *ScalarIV, Value *Step, Instruction *EntryVal,
1817 Value *ScalarIV = nullptr; in widenIntOrFpInduction() local
1859 ScalarIV = Induction; in widenIntOrFpInduction()
1861 ScalarIV = IV->getType()->isIntegerTy() in widenIntOrFpInduction()
1865 ScalarIV = emitTransformedIndex(Builder, ScalarIV, PSE.getSE(), DL, ID); in widenIntOrFpInduction()
1866 ScalarIV->setName("offset.idx"); in widenIntOrFpInduction()
1872 ScalarIV = Builder.CreateTrunc(ScalarIV, TruncType); in widenIntOrFpInduction()
1881 Value *Broadcasted = getBroadcastInstrs(ScalarIV); in widenIntOrFpInduction()
1899 buildScalarSteps(ScalarIV, Step, EntryVal, ID); in widenIntOrFpInduction()
1958 void InnerLoopVectorizer::buildScalarSteps(Value *ScalarIV, Value *Step, in buildScalarSteps() argument
[all …]